Understanding the Mechanics of CAPTCHA Solver AI

CAPTCHA solver AI, at its core, leverages sophisticated machine learning algorithms to automate the process of solving CAPTCHAs.

This automation can manifest in various forms, each designed to overcome different types of CAPTCHA challenges.

Image Recognition and Classification

The most common form of CAPTCHA involves distorted text or images requiring identification.

AI models, particularly those based on Convolutional Neural Networks CNNs, are highly effective at this.

  • Training Data: These AI systems are trained on vast datasets containing millions of CAPTCHA images paired with their correct solutions. This process allows the AI to learn intricate patterns, distortions, and variations.
  • Feature Extraction: During recognition, the AI extracts features from the CAPTCHA image, such as edges, corners, and textures, much like a human eye would process visual information.
  • Pattern Matching: It then matches these extracted features against the patterns learned during its training phase, attempting to correctly identify characters or objects.
  • Example: For a reCAPTCHA “select all squares with traffic lights,” the AI segments the image into squares and classifies the content of each square using its trained visual recognition capabilities.
  • Data Point: According to a 2023 report from a cybersecurity firm, advanced deep learning models can achieve over 95% accuracy on simple text-based CAPTCHAs, a testament to their impressive pattern recognition abilities.

Audio CAPTCHA Transcripts

For visually impaired users, audio CAPTCHAs provide an alternative.

AI solvers for these rely on advanced speech-to-text STT technologies. Cloudflare extension

  • Noise Reduction: Audio CAPTCHAs often include background noise or distortions to make them harder for machines. AI solvers first employ noise reduction algorithms to clean the audio signal.
  • Phoneme Recognition: The cleaned audio is then broken down into phonemes the smallest units of sound that distinguish one word from another.
  • Language Models: These phonemes are fed into sophisticated language models that predict the sequence of words or numbers, effectively transcribing the audio.
  • Challenge: The varying accents, speeds, and audio distortions present significant challenges, yet AI has made remarkable strides.
  • Data Point: Google’s own STT API, when tested on a clean audio dataset, shows an impressive word error rate WER as low as 4-5%, illustrating the power of modern audio processing AI. However, real-world CAPTCHA audio is far more complex.

Behavioral Analysis and Heuristics

Modern CAPTCHAs, like Google’s reCAPTCHA v3, move beyond simple challenges to analyze user behavior in the background, making AI circumvention far more intricate.

  • Mouse Movements: AI might attempt to simulate realistic human mouse movements – not perfectly linear, but with slight tremors and curves.
  • Typing Patterns: Variations in typing speed, pauses between keystrokes, and common human errors can be mimicked.
  • Browsing History & IP Reputation: Some CAPTCHA systems consider the user’s IP address reputation and past browsing behavior. AI tools might utilize proxy networks to rotate IP addresses or attempt to simulate a history of legitimate browsing.
  • Browser Fingerprinting: Websites can identify unique browser configurations. AI might attempt to randomize or spoof these fingerprints to appear less suspicious.

Strengthening Legitimate Security Measures

The focus should be on building more robust security systems that are difficult for bots to bypass, thereby rendering CAPTCHA solver AI irrelevant.

  • Behavioral Analytics: Implement advanced behavioral analytics that monitor genuine user patterns. This goes beyond simple mouse movements and analyzes a holistic range of interactions to identify anomalies.
  • Multi-Factor Authentication MFA: Encourage and implement MFA for sensitive actions, adding layers of security beyond a single CAPTCHA challenge. This is a proven method for significantly reducing account compromise risks.
  • Threat Intelligence Sharing: Collaborate within the cybersecurity community to share threat intelligence, identifying new bot patterns and attack vectors more rapidly.
  • Data Point: A Microsoft report found that MFA can block over 99.9% of automated attacks, demonstrating its effectiveness compared to relying solely on CAPTCHAs.

What is the difference between an AI CAPTCHA solver and a human CAPTCHA farm?

An AI CAPTCHA solver uses artificial intelligence to automatically solve CAPTCHAs.

A human CAPTCHA farm, on the other hand, employs large numbers of human workers, often in low-wage countries, to manually solve CAPTCHAs for clients.

Both are used to bypass security, but one uses technology and the other uses human labor.
